Peanut Butter Mousse Recipe


  • Author: Mariam
  • Total Time: 4 hours 20 minutes (including chilling time)
  • Yield: 5-6 servings 1x

Description

This creamy and luscious Peanut Butter Mousse combines the rich flavor of peanut butter with a light, airy texture. Perfect for a no-bake dessert, it features a whipped cream base enhanced with gelatin for stability and sweetened with brown and powdered sugar. Finished with a dollop of homemade whipped cream and optional chocolate garnish, this mousse is an elegant and indulgent treat perfect for any occasion.


Ingredients

Scale

Gelatin Mixture

  • ¼ teaspoon powdered gelatin
  • ½ tablespoon cold water

Mousse Base

  • 1 cup (280g) creamy peanut butter
  • 3 tablespoons (42g) light brown sugar (packed)
  • 1 cup (240ml) heavy whipping cream (cold, divided)

Whipped Cream for Mousse Folding

  • ¼ cup (29g) powdered sugar
  • ½ teaspoon vanilla extract
  • ¼ cup (300ml) heavy whipping cream (cold)
  • ¼ cup (29g) powdered sugar
  • ½ teaspoon vanilla extract

Garnish (Optional)

  • Chocolate chips or chocolate shavings

Instructions

  1. Bloom the Gelatin: Add the cold water to a small bowl and sprinkle the powdered gelatin evenly over it, ensuring all the gelatin contacts the water. Stir if necessary and allow it to bloom for 5 minutes until firm.
  2. Combine Peanut Butter and Cream: In a large bowl, add 1 cup of cold heavy whipping cream and the brown sugar to the peanut butter. Gently fold and stir the mixture until well combined. The peanut butter will first thin out and then thicken up again.
  3. Melt the Gelatin and Mix: After blooming, heat the gelatin in the microwave for 8-10 seconds until melted. Quickly add the melted gelatin to the peanut butter mixture and fold until thoroughly incorporated.
  4. Whip Remaining Cream: In a large mixing bowl, combine the remaining 1¼ cups of heavy whipping cream, powdered sugar, and vanilla extract. Whip on high speed until stiff peaks form.
  5. Fold Whipped Cream into Peanut Butter Mixture: Gently fold about one-third of the whipped cream into the peanut butter base until combined, then fold in the remaining whipped cream carefully to maintain the airy texture without any streaks.
  6. Chill the Mousse: Divide the peanut butter mousse evenly into 5-6 glass cups or serving dishes. Refrigerate for 3-4 hours or overnight until fully set and firm.
  7. Prepare Whipped Cream Topping: In a separate bowl, whip together the heavy whipping cream, powdered sugar, and vanilla extract until stiff peaks form for the topping.
  8. Decorate and Serve: Pipe or spoon the whipped cream topping over each mousse serving. Garnish with chocolate chips or shavings if desired. Keep refrigerated until serving and consume within 3-4 days for best quality.

Notes

  • Ensure the gelatin is completely dissolved and incorporated smoothly to avoid lumps in the mousse.
  • Use cold heavy whipping cream to achieve the best whipping results and mousse texture.
  • Allow the mousse to chill sufficiently to set well and have the proper consistency for serving.
  • This mousse can be prepared up to a day in advance for convenience.
  • For a richer flavor, use natural peanut butter without added salt or sugar.
